Predicting Team Formations and Player Roles in Professional Football

Thursday 20 March 2025


The pursuit of understanding how teams work together has long been a fascinating area of study in sports analytics. In recent years, researchers have made significant strides in developing methods to analyze team formations and player roles in football. A new paper takes this research one step further by proposing an innovative approach to modeling the dynamics of team strategy.


At its core, the paper presents a novel method for analyzing the complex relationships between players on the field. By using data from professional football matches, researchers were able to develop a system that can accurately predict how teams will form and how players will interact with each other during a game.


The key innovation lies in the use of permutations, or re-orderings of player positions, to model the different ways in which teams can set up on the field. This allows researchers to account for the vast array of possible team formations and strategies that are used in professional football.


To develop their system, the researchers began by analyzing a large dataset of match statistics from professional football leagues around the world. From this data, they were able to identify patterns and trends in how teams set up on the field and how players interact with each other during a game.


Next, the researchers developed a mathematical model that could be used to predict how teams would form and interact on the field based on these patterns and trends. The model was tested using a series of simulations, which were designed to mimic the conditions of real-world football matches.


The results of the study were impressive, with the researchers finding that their system was able to accurately predict team formations and player roles in over 90% of cases. This level of accuracy is unprecedented in the field of sports analytics, and opens up new possibilities for teams looking to gain a competitive edge on the field.


One potential application of this technology is in the area of player recruitment and development. By being able to analyze and predict how different players will interact with each other on the field, teams may be able to make more informed decisions about which players to sign and how to develop their skills.


In addition, the system could also be used to help teams optimize their team formations and strategies during games. By being able to predict how different formations and strategies will play out, coaches may be able to make more effective decisions about when to switch things up and adapt to changing circumstances on the field.
